Elk Valley RCMP seeking stolen boat

Police are still looking for suspects in the theft of a boat and matching trailer worth over $220,000 and are asking the public is asked to keep an eye out.

Elk Valley RCMP officials said the call came in on Sunday shortly before 9 a.m., alleging that the boat was taken from a property along the 1300 block of Cypress Drive in Sparwood.

The caller said the boat, a 2021 black and yellow Mastercraft X26, and a matching tri-axle trailer were stored at a friend’s residence over the winter.

“The boat was wrapped in a blue coloured tarp for protection over the winter, but the trailer would be easily distinguishable considering the unique colour scheme,” said Elk Valley RCMP.

According to the report, it was supposed to be picked up for warranty work by the dealer, and the hitch lock was removed in anticipation.

While the homeowner was working, unknown suspects took the boat from the property.

“Believing it was the dealer making the pick-up, it was not reported stolen for several days until the dealer did come to the location to retrieve the boat,” said police officials.

Police said canvassing the neighbourhood turned up no witnesses or security camera footage.

RCMP are asking anyone in Sparwood Heights around the Cypress Drive area with security cameras to review their footage for any suspicious activity or images of the boat and trailer being removed from the area.

Police are continuing their investigation into the incident.

“Anyone with information, can contact a Police officer at 250-425-6233 or use BC Crime Stoppers at 1-800-222-TIPS(8477). Please refer to file 2023-1082,” said Elk Valley RCMP.
